Asian Games: India bag gold in women's 4 x 400m relay

Image

ANI Jakarta [Indonesia]

Indian team, comprising Hima Das, Machettira Poovamma, Saritaben Laxmanbhai Gayakwad and Velluva Koroth Vismaya, on Thursday bagged a gold medal in Women's 4 x 400m Relay event at the ongoing 18th edition of the Asian Games.

The team claimed a top-podium finish after they completed the race within a clock timing of 3:28.72 in the final round.

While Bahrain squad won silver with a clock timing of 3:30.61, Vietnamese athletes settled for bronze as they clocked 3:33:23.

In Sepak Takraw, India lost 0-2 to Thailand in women's Quadrant Preliminary Group B match while, India's Zahan Kevic Setalvad and Kaevaan Kevic Setalvad finished on 24th and 36th spot, respectively, in Jumping Individual Equestrian event.

 

India's total medal tally at the prestigious tournament now stands at 58-thirteen gold, 20 silver and 25 bronze.
